"Beginning in October, the search and ads giant will affix +1 buttons to
ads in its behemoth Google Display Network," reports ClickZ. "Mobile and desktop ad units
across the network will carry the +1 badge, which is the Google
equivalent of Facebook's 'Like' button. Importantly, small footnotes at
the bottom of each ad will show how many others have '+1'd' it. In cases
where an individual's Google+ friend has +1'd an ad, the ad will
reflect that and possibly show the friend's Google profile image." Read more. In theory, this will 'send' every ad for which someone has clicked the +1 button into the social networking world--bypassing giant Facebook.
